ABOUT ATAL

The AICTE Training and Learning (ATAL) initiative offers Faculty Development Programmes (FDPs) for faculty, postgraduate students, researchers, and industry professionals.These programs:

  • Provide domain expertise and practical skills with industry connections.
  • Develop leadership for academic excellence.
  • Foster awareness of community, nation-building, and career growth.
  • Enhance communication for effective teaching and learning.

ATAL aims to create a network of skilled professionals committed to knowledge sharing, innovation, and societal impact.

FOCUS AREAS & TOPICS
  1. Quantum Computing Foundations (Superposition, Entanglement, Qubits)
  2. Quantum Algorithms (Shor’s, Grover’s, Quantum Annealing)
  3. Quantum Machine Learning (Hybrid AI & Quantum Systems)
  4. Quantum Cryptography(QKD,Post-Quantum Security)
  5. Quantum Communication (Quantum Internet, Satellite Communication)
  6. Quantum Hardware & Platforms (Superconducting Qubits, Trapped Ions, Photonic Qubits)
  7. Quantum Sensors & Metrology (Precision Measurement, Navigation, Medical Imaging)
  8. Quantum Computing Frameworks (IBM Qiskit, Google Cirq, Rigetti Forest)
  9. Error Correction & Noise Mitigation (Fault-Tolerant Quantum Computing)
  10. Future Trends & Industry Applications (Finance, Healthcare, Material Science, AI)
ABOUT FDP

The Faculty Development Program (FDP) on “Quantum Computing & Technology: Bridging Theory and Applications” is designed to provide faculty members,research scholars, and industry professionals with a deep understanding of quantum computing principles and their real-world applications. This program aims to demystify complex quantum theories while offering practical exposure to quantum algorithms, quantum hardware, and quantum programming platforms. Participants will explore the potential of quantum computing in revolutionizing areas like cryptography, optimization, drug discovery, and artificial intelligence. The FDP also aims to foster collaborative discussions on current research challenges and future directions in this rapidly evolving field.
